datagrid中打开新窗体
DataGrid1.Attributes.Add( " onclick " , " window.open('Print_GoodsMove.aspx?GoodsMove_ID= " + Apply_ID + " ','newwindow', 'height=600, width=745, top=100, left=100, toolbar=no, menubar=no, scrollbars=no, resizable=no,location=no, status=no'); " );
跨页面实现多选
SelectMultiPages.aspx.cs using System; using System.Collections; using System.ComponentModel; using System.Data; using System.Data.OleDb; using System.Drawing; using System.Web; using System.Web.SessionState; using System.Web.UI; using System.Web.UI.WebControls; using System.Web.UI.HtmlControls; namespace eMeng.Exam
如何给DataGrid添加自动增长列
我们用Northwind数据库做例子: html页面的DataGrid如下所示: < asp:datagrid id ="grdTest" runat ="server" Height ="228px" Width ="262px" AutoGenerateColumns ="False" AllowPaging ="True" > < Columns > < asp:TemplateColumn > < ItemTemplate > <!-- 这里是关键 --> < SPAN >
在多线程里查询数据库并填充dataGrid
在查询大数据量时,窗体界面会不动,“正在查询 ”的提示也不能显示。所以打算用多线程来实现, 可是当在线程里面执行到 this .dataGridDF.DataSource = dt.DefaultView;填充数据 时却提示报错,说什么该线程不能调用主线程创建的控件等等。 后来查了许多资料,终于搞定。可以在查询数据库时操作别的了,“正在查询 ”的提示也显示了。 // 或者在前面用一个线程查询,在线程里调用dataGrid.BeginInvoke(异步方法)来单独填充 public delegate void myDelegate(); DataTable dt; private void btnDianJia_Click( object sender, System.EventArgs e)
相关文章:
2021-12-20
2022-01-04
2021-05-08
2022-01-09
2022-12-23
2022-12-23
2022-12-23
2021-07-15
猜你喜欢
2021-07-26
2021-10-08
2022-02-25
2021-11-21
相关资源
下载
2022-12-23
下载
2023-01-24
下载
2021-06-05
下载
2022-12-14
下载
2023-01-30